Phone

Address

25 Aylmer Road, Aylmer Parade
London
N2 0PE

Map

Map for Da Vinci Ristorante

Food types

We don't know what they serve here yet.

Menu

Menu for Da Vinci Ristorante

Reviews

No one has left a review yet.